The case revolves around claims that between January 17, 2025, and November 13, 2025, Plug Power misled investors by overstating the likelihood of funding availability from a Department of Energy loan and misrepresented its prospects for constructing hydrogen production facilities. These alleged misstatements, according to the filing, significantly impacted the company's stock performance, leading to considerable investor losses.
